Symptoms:

  • When attempting to import/embed a protected document (Excel, Word, PDF, etc.) into another document, the operation fails
  • This failure occurs regardless of whether the target document is protected or non-protected
  • Users may receive error messages indicating the import operation cannot be completed
  • The embedding functionality is blocked at the system level



Expected Behaviour:

  • Importing non-protected documents into protected documents works as expected (with Full Control permissions on the target protected document)
  • Importing non-protected documents into other non-protected documents functions normally
  • Protected documents cannot be embedded into any document - this is intentional security behaviour


Root Cause:

  • Protected documents have embedded security policies that prevent them from being imported or embedded into other files
  • This restriction applies to all scenarios: protected-to-protected, protected-to-non-protected
  • The security framework is designed to prevent potential data leakage and maintain protection integrity
  • This behaviour strengthens overall document security by preventing bypass of protection controls


Resolution/Workaround:

  1. Verify Protection Status: Ensure the source document being imported is not protected

  2. If Content Reuse is Required:

    • Unprotect the source file (if policy permissions allow)
    • Copy and paste content manually (subject to policy restrictions)
    • Work with unprotected versions of the documents
    • Use alternative content sharing methods that comply with organizational policies
  3. For Protected Target Documents: Ensure you have Full Control permissions when importing unprotected content
